Transaction e5ca205729abd2df160a7a0dc7d481808beb2e39ed7e8d91554859788fac35bb

1 Input
2 Outputs
  • e5ca205729abd2df160a7a0dc7d481808beb2e39ed7e8d91554859788fac35bb:0
  • value  10459045
    address  3C1UTFRLkrg9smVXdL9yTABvkacWKC9upq
  • e5ca205729abd2df160a7a0dc7d481808beb2e39ed7e8d91554859788fac35bb:1
  • value  267782
    address  3Li5onZucLNU6jowUho824PrDGhyqAzWSc